2. Decide on a legal structure for your business
a. Decide how much personal liability protection you need
b. Decide how you want your business to be taxed
c. Research the various types of ownership structures
1. Sole proprietorship
2. LLC
3. C Corp
4. S Corp
The choice you make will have a large impact on how legal issues are handled. Sole proprietorship is the simplest legal structure but it does not protect your personal assets. Forming an LLC is more complex and expensive. However, it is designed to provide the limited liability features of a corporation and the tax efficiencies of a partnership. This is a popular choice for sole proprietors who are looking to incorporate simply to protect personal assets.
